Python Engineer (Analytics & Insights Services)

1 Month ago • 5 Years + • Programming

Job Summary

Job Description

Manychat is looking for a Python Engineer to develop and maintain Python services for data aggregation and analysis. This role involves building and exposing APIs, optimizing algorithms for large-scale data processing, integrating machine learning and AI components, and collaborating with the Data Engineering team. The engineer will participate in sprint planning, ensure code quality, and contribute to creating real-time metrics engines. This role aims to strengthen customer engagement and support growth through intelligent automation.
Must have:
  • 5+ years of Python development experience.
  • Experience with web frameworks (FastAPI).
  • Solid SQL skills and experience with databases.
  • Proficiency with data processing libraries.
  • Experience with containerization and orchestration.
  • Familiarity with DevOps practices and CI/CD pipelines.
  • Basic understanding of machine learning principles.
  • Excellent communication skills and Agile team experience.
Good to have:
  • Proficiency with cloud platforms and their analytics services.
  • Background in building recommendation systems or automated analytics dashboards.
  • Familiarity with MLOps tools (MLflow, Kubeflow, Airflow).
Perks:
  • Relocation support with tickets, accommodation, and bonus.
  • Professional development budget.
  • Flexible benefits plan.
  • Health insurance including dentistry, psychology, nutrition, surgery, and travel assistance.

Job Details

WHO WE ARE 🌍

Manychat is a leading Chat Marketing platform. We help businesses engage with their customers on Instagram, Facebook Messenger, WhatsApp, and Telegram.

Trusted by over 1 million brands in 170+ countries, we're an official Meta Business Partner, backed by top investors, including Bessemer Venture Partners.

With 200+ teammates across international offices in Barcelona, Austin, Amsterdam, São Paulo, and Yerevan — Manychat helps businesses across the globe improve their ROI and grow faster.

OUR TEAM 🌟

We are developing high-performance Python services that ingest, process, and analyze data from multiple sources to generate actionable insights within our product. The project involves close collaboration with the Data Engineering team to design robust data pipelines and with the Product team to seamlessly integrate analytics into the user interface. In the near term, we plan to enhance our platform with AI/ML capabilities for advanced statistical processing and personalized recommendations. Key deliverables include building scalable APIs, optimizing ETL workflows, and creating real-time metrics engines. Our analytics will be embedded in dashboards, widgets, and an AI Copilot to empower customers with data-driven decision-making. This initiative aims to strengthen customer engagement, drive conversions, and support growth through intelligent automation.🚀

 

WHAT YOU’LL DO 🤖

  • Design, develop, and maintain Python services for data aggregation and analysis.
  • Build and expose APIs or internal components to deliver results to the Product team.
  • Optimize algorithms for large-scale data processing.
  • Integrate machine learning and AI components.
  • Implement monitoring, logging, and alerting for all services.
  • Collaborate with Data Engineering to align on ETL pipelines and data ingestion processes.
  • Participate in sprint planning and task estimation alongside the Product team.
  • Ensure code quality via code reviews, unit and integration tests, and up-to-date documentation.

WHAT YOU’LL BRING 💥

  • 5+ years of professional Python development experience.
  • Experience with web frameworks (FastAPI).
  • Solid SQL skills and experience with databases (Snowflake, Vertica, Clickhouse or similar) and NoSQL stores (Redis).
  • Proficiency with data processing libraries: Pandas, NumPy, Dask or similar.
  • Experience with containerization and orchestration (Docker, Kubernetes).
  • Familiarity with DevOps practices and CI/CD pipelines (GitLab CI, GitHub Actions, or similar).
  • Basic understanding of machine learning principles and experience deploying ML & LLM models.
  • Excellent communication skills and experience working in Agile teams.

NICE TO HAVE SKILLS 🛠️

  • Proficiency with cloud platforms and their analytics services (Redshift, BigQuery, Snowflake).
  • Background in building recommendation systems or automated analytics dashboards.
  • Familiarity with MLOps tools (MLflow, Kubeflow, Airflow).

 

WHAT WE OFFER 🤗

We care about your growth, well-being, and comfort

  • Candidates outside of Amsterdam can start onboarding and complete the probation period remotely with further relocation to the city for a hybrid work format ( with free meals and snacks in the office).
  • Relocation support through airplane tickets, accommodations for up to three weeks, and a relocation bonus.
  • Professional development budget for relevant conference tickets, training programs, or courses.
  • Flexible benefits plan to choose the perks that fit your needs.
  • Health insurance, including dentistry, psychology sessions, nutrition consultations, surgery, and travel assistance

Manychat is an Equal Opportunity Employer. We’re committed to building a diverse and inclusive team. We do not discriminate against qualified employees or applicants because of race, color, religion, gender identity, sex, sexual preference, sexual identity, pregnancy, national origin, ancestry, citizenship, age, marital status, physical disability, mental disability, medical condition, military status, or any other characteristic protected by local law or ordinance.

This commitment is also reflected through our candidate experience. If you have individual needs that may require an accommodation during the interview process, please indicate this in your application. We will do our best to provide assistance throughout your interview process to ensure you’re set up for success.

With my application, I accept the Manychat Privacy Policy.

Similar Jobs

Coda - Senior/Staff Software Engineer

Coda

Bangkok, Bangkok, Thailand (Hybrid)
1 Year ago
Black Bery - QNX Senior Technical Project Manager

Black Bery

Ottawa, Ontario, Canada (On-Site)
1 Month ago
Sika Group - Program Manager

Sika Group

Pune, Maharashtra, India (On-Site)
1 Month ago
Nahc.io - Business Development Director

Nahc.io

United States (Remote)
2 Months ago
Rockstar Games - Associate Principal Analytics Engineer

Rockstar Games

Edinburgh, Scotland, United Kingdom (On-Site)
2 Months ago
Blackshark - Senior Software Engineer - Python

Blackshark

United States (Remote)
1 Month ago
JDA - Staff Software Engineer (Python)

JDA

Scottsdale, Arizona, United States (On-Site)
1 Month ago
QuinStreet - Java Developer Contractor

QuinStreet

Pune, Maharashtra, India (Remote)
4 Weeks ago
The Walt Disney Company - Specialist, Programming and Content Curation

The Walt Disney Company

Bangkok, Bangkok, Thailand (On-Site)
2 Months ago
KPIT - C++ Expert

KPIT

Bengaluru, Karnataka, India (Hybrid)
9 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

nord current - Office Administrator

nord current

Vilnius, Vilnius County, Lithuania (On-Site)
5 Months ago
Tesla - Automotive Mechatronics/Mechanic

Tesla

Bavaria, Germany (On-Site)
4 Months ago
IGG - Senior Game Designer

IGG

Singapore (On-Site)
8 Months ago
Capgemini - Business Advisor - A

Capgemini

Mumbai, Maharashtra, India (On-Site)
3 Weeks ago
London stock Exchange - Software Quality Engineer

London stock Exchange

Nottingham, England, United Kingdom (On-Site)
2 Months ago
PwC - SAP FICO Senior Manager

PwC

Makati City, Metro Manila, Philippines (On-Site)
9 Months ago
Schbang - Business Growth Manager

Schbang

Mumbai, Maharashtra, India (On-Site)
4 Months ago
Argus - Site Reliability Engineer

Argus

Calgary, Alberta, Canada (Remote)
3 Months ago
Cognite - Senior Implementation Project Manager

Cognite

Austin, Texas, United States (Hybrid)
1 Month ago
Tesla - Key Account Manager

Tesla

Bavaria, Germany (On-Site)
4 Months ago

Get notifed when new similar jobs are uploaded

Jobs in Amsterdam, North Holland, Netherlands

Thales - Functional Safety Specialist

Thales

Hengelo, Overijssel, Netherlands (Hybrid)
1 Month ago
miniclip - Android developer

miniclip

Netherlands (On-Site)
1 Month ago
Beyond Sports - 3D Artist - Generalist - Blender/Unity

Beyond Sports

Alkmaar, North Holland, Netherlands (On-Site)
3 Months ago
Adyen - Solutions Engineer

Adyen

Amsterdam, North Holland, Netherlands (On-Site)
1 Month ago
Tesla - Service Technician

Tesla

South Holland, Netherlands (On-Site)
4 Months ago
Philips - Service Readiness Lead

Philips

Eindhoven, North Brabant, Netherlands (On-Site)
3 Weeks ago
Hawkeye Innovations - Match Operations Assistant

Hawkeye Innovations

Amsterdam, North Holland, Netherlands (On-Site)
2 Months ago
Tesla - Senior Software Engineer (Backend, .Net)

Tesla

Amsterdam, North Holland, Netherlands (On-Site)
4 Months ago
Tesla - Service Advisor

Tesla

Utrecht, Utrecht, Netherlands (On-Site)
4 Months ago
Illumina - Customer Care Specialist

Illumina

Eindhoven, North Brabant, Netherlands (Hybrid)
3 Weeks ago

Get notifed when new similar jobs are uploaded

Programming Jobs

PlayStation Global - Senior Pipeline Programmer

PlayStation Global

Los Angeles, California, United States (Remote)
3 Months ago
Nagarro - Staff Engineer, Java

Nagarro

Sri Lanka (Remote)
8 Months ago
HCL Tech - Technical Lead - Embedded C

HCL Tech

California, United States (On-Site)
1 Month ago
TransUnion - Software Developer

TransUnion

Heredia, Costa Rica (Remote)
1 Month ago
Siemens  - Software Developer - SQL

Siemens

Pune, Maharashtra, India (On-Site)
1 Month ago
Next Level Business Services - Java - Scala Architect

Next Level Business Services

San Diego, California, United States (On-Site)
8 Months ago
Eqvilent - C++ TEAM LEAD (MARKETS EXPANSION)

Eqvilent

(Remote)
7 Months ago
BeamNG - Senior C++ Programmer

BeamNG

Germany (Remote)
2 Weeks ago
FORTUNE - Engineering Manager (.NET, AWS)

FORTUNE

India (On-Site)
3 Weeks ago
version 1 - Intermediate Java Software Engineer

version 1

London, England, United Kingdom (On-Site)
4 Months ago

Get notifed when new similar jobs are uploaded